首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
在考生文件夹下创建一个下拉式菜单mymenu.mnx,并生成菜单程序mymenu.mpr。运行该菜单程序时会在当前Visual FoxPro系统菜单的末尾追加一个“考试”子菜单,如下图所示。 “计算”和“返回”菜单命令的功能都通过执行“过程”完成
在考生文件夹下创建一个下拉式菜单mymenu.mnx,并生成菜单程序mymenu.mpr。运行该菜单程序时会在当前Visual FoxPro系统菜单的末尾追加一个“考试”子菜单,如下图所示。 “计算”和“返回”菜单命令的功能都通过执行“过程”完成
admin
2017-02-28
74
问题
在考生文件夹下创建一个下拉式菜单mymenu.mnx,并生成菜单程序mymenu.mpr。运行该菜单程序时会在当前Visual FoxPro系统菜单的末尾追加一个“考试”子菜单,如下图所示。
“计算”和“返回”菜单命令的功能都通过执行“过程”完成。
“计算”菜单命令的功能如下:
(1)用ALTER TABLE语句在order表中添加一个“总金额”字段,该字段为数值型,宽度为7,小数位数为2。
(2)根据orderitem表和goods表中的相关数据计算各订单的总金额,其中,一个订单的总金额等于它所包含的各商品的金额之和,每种商品的金额等于其数量乘以单价,填入刚建立的字段中。
“返回”菜单命令的功能是恢复到Visual FoxPro的系统菜单。
菜单程序生成后,运行菜单程序,并依次执行“计算”和“返回”菜单命令。
选项
答案
步骤1:新建一个菜单,按要求输入菜单项的名称。 步骤2:写入菜单项“计算”的代码如下。 *****“计算”菜单项中的代码***** ALTER TABLE ORDER ADD总金额N(7,2) SELECT Orderitem.订单号,sum(goods.单价*orderitem.数量)as总金额; FROM goods,orderitem; WHERE Goods.商品号=Orderitem.商品号; GROUP BY Orderitem.订单号; ORDER BY Orderitem.订单号; INTO TABLE temp.dbf CLOSE ALL SELECT 1 USE TEMP INDEX ON订单号TO ddh1. SELE 2 USE ORDER INDEX ON订单号TO ddh2 SET RELATION TO订单号INTO A DO WHILE.NOT.EOF() REPLACE总金额WITH temp.总金额 SKIP ENDDO BROW ************************************* 步骤3:写入菜单项“返回”中的过程代码为 SET SYSMENU TO DEFAULT 步骤4:保存菜单名为“mymenu”并生成可执行文件。运行菜单。
解析
按要求建立菜单,本题将计算出的总金额添加到表中字段部分较难,需要为表建立临时联系。
转载请注明原文地址:https://kaotiyun.com/show/3cIp777K
本试题收录于:
二级VF题库NCRE全国计算机二级分类
0
二级VF
NCRE全国计算机二级
相关试题推荐
SQL语句中删除视图的命令是()。
在VisualFoxPro中,用于建立或修改程序文件的命令是()。
结构化程序设计的基本原则不包括()。
程序流程图中带有箭头的线段表示的是()。
按如下要求完成综合应用(所有控件的属性必须在表单设计器的属性窗口中设置):(1)根据“项目信息”、“零件信息”和“使用零件”3个表建立一个查询(注意表之间的连接字段),该查询包括项目号、项目名、零件名称和数量4个字段,并要求先按项目号升序排列,项
在考生文件夹下完成如下简单应用:(1)modil.prg程序文件中SQLSELECT语句的功能是查询目前用于3个项目的零件(零件名称),并将结果按升序存入文本文件results.txt中。给出的SQLSELECT语句中在第1、3、5行各有一处错误
在考生文件夹下完成如下基本操作:(1)通过SQLINSERT语句插入元组(”p7”,”PN7”,1020)到“零件信息”表(注意不要重复执行插入操作),并将相应的SQL语句存储在文件one.prg中。(2)通过SQLDELETE语句从“
设计一个表单名和文件名均为form_item的表单,其中,所有控件的属性必须在表单设计器的属性窗口中设置。表单的标题设为“使用零件情况统计”。表单中有一个组合框(Combo1)、一个文本框(Text1)、两个命令按钮“统计”(Com-mand1)和“退出”
在考生文件夹下完成下列操作:(1)建立一个文件名和表单名均为myform的表单,表单中包括一个列表框(List1)和两个命令按钮(Command1和Command2),两个命令按钮的标题分别为“计算”和“退出”。(2)列表框(Listl)中
在考生文件夹下完成下列操作:为了查询不同歌手演唱的歌曲,请设计一个表单mform.SCX,其界面如下图所示:表单控件名为formone,表单的标题为“歌曲查询”。表单左侧有一个标签控件Labelone,显示内容为“输入歌手姓名”,一个文本
随机试题
________comesbackfirstissupposedtowintheprize.
需要骨髓铁染色进行鉴别诊断的是
A.副作用B.毒性作用C.过敏反应D.二重感染E.后遗效应猪长期使用乙酰甲喹后,可引起肝、肾损害,此作用属于
关于牙髓钙化,说法错误的是
根据海洋法的规定,沿海国在一定情况下行使紧追权。下列行使紧追权的行为哪个是符合规则的?
民事主体对智力成果依法享有的专有权利是( )。( )是财产权的对称。
关于利用网络计划中工作自由时差的说法,正确的是()。
页框控件也称作选项卡控件,在一个页框中可以有多个页面,页面个数的属性是
以下程序的执行结果为______。#include<iostream>usingnamespacestd;classbase{public:virtualvoidwho(){
Lookattheofficeplanbelow.Forquestions6-10,decidewhodoesthesejobs.Foreachquestion,markoneletter(A-H)onyour
最新回复
(
0
)